Manaksia Coated Q1 FY27 Results (NSE: MANAKCOAT)
Signal: Margin expansion
The read
Margin expansion story intact — 4th straight quarter of OPM expansion (+100bps YoY to 11%) — but top-line growth decelerated sharply to +4.9% YoY (vs +28.9% in Q1FY26) and PAT was flat as finance costs surged 50% and other income collapsed 78%. Equity dilution caused EPS to decline YoY despite flat PAT.

P&L walk
Revenue growth slowed to +4.9% YoY (vs +28.9% YoY in Q1FY26) but margins improved 100bps YoY to 11% OPM, marking the 4th straight quarter of margin expansion. PAT was flat (+0.7% YoY) as higher other income was offset by a 49.6% jump in finance cost and lower other income.
Key positives
- OPM expanded 100bps YoY to 11%, marking the 4th consecutive quarter of margin improvement
- Revenue sequentially rebounded 15.3% from Q4FY26 (₹22,745.73 lakh to ₹26,214.09 lakh)
- RoCE at 19.86% and ROE at 14.14% remain healthy for the sector
Key concerns
- Revenue growth decelerated sharply to +4.9% YoY from +28.9% in Q1FY26, suggesting demand softening or high-base effect
- Finance cost jumped 49.6% YoY, compressing bottom-line absorption
- Other income dropped 77.6% YoY (₹92.54 lakh vs ₹413.64 lakh), removing a prior profit support
- PAT flat (+0.7% YoY) and EPS declined 6.3% YoY due to equity dilution
